Transaction 15d8d8d0a46dbbe8645d3ea1d0158329423db589fd904d500c035b9302fcac47

5 Input
1 Outputs
  • 15d8d8d0a46dbbe8645d3ea1d0158329423db589fd904d500c035b9302fcac47:0
  • value  5127289
    address  3CnfrYYV4DKuxsyJB88M1HYcw4TKRyia7R